Interpersonal relationships are often evaluated through dramatic moments of conflict or explicit betrayal, leading us to overlook subtle, daily patterns of emotional neglect. We convince ourselves that as long as someone isn't actively cruel, they must genuinely care about our well-being. Examining the quiet, low-visibility behaviors that signal true emotional indifference is essential for protecting our emotional health and setting healthy relational boundaries.

The piece highlights how indifference rarely looks like active hostility; instead, it manifests as passive conversational narcissism and selective emotional engagement. When someone consistently redirects conversations back to themselves, forgets major life details you've shared, or offers support only when convenient, they reveal a fundamental lack of psychological investment. Real care is demonstrated through sustained, quiet attention rather than grand performative gestures.

Recognizing these subtle patterns requires abandoning excuses and trusting subtle behavioral evidence over comfortable words. Continuing to invest deep emotional energy into one-sided relationships creates chronic emotional drain and prevents us from cultivating authentic, reciprocal connections. Setting healthy boundaries begins with seeing relational reality clearly without self-deception.
